James Gunn’s Unique Vision for the New Superman Movie

As anticipation builds for one of the most iconic superheroes to grace the big screen, filmmaker James Gunn reflects on the intricate balance between creating blockbuster cinema for different universes. Known for his masterful direction of the Guardians of the Galaxy films, Gunn now immerses himself in the expansive world of DC, particularly with the upcoming release of Superman. With a release date set for July 11, 2025, this project marks an exciting chapter for both Gunn and DC Studios.

Gunn’s transition from Marvel to DC signifies more than just a shift in Studio allegiances; it represents a transformative leap in his career, where he is now at the helm of safeguarding the future of DC’s cinematic universe. His recent appearance on the DC Studios Showcase Podcast offers intriguing insights into how he approaches filmmaking differently between these two iconic franchises. Unlike the misfit humor seen in Guardians of the Galaxy, Gunn emphasizes the importance of creating a narrative that resonates with everyone when it comes to Superman.

“So it’s really important, for instance, when we’re making Superman, we’re making a movie for everybody,” Gunn remarked. This key distinction highlights his commitment to crafting a story that appeals broadly, a task he acknowledges is layered with its unique set of challenges.

He continues to elaborate on the meticulous nature of filmmaking, where every creative choice carries weight. “I really have to run it past other people, get opinions, get a real audience’s opinions.” These statements encapsulate Gunn’s collaborative spirit and the respect he holds for his audience. This dedication to audience engagement doesn’t just enhance the film’s quality; it fundamentally affects its commercial viability.

The stakes are undoubtedly high. With the impending reboot of Superman, Gunn is not just a director but a co-CEO of DC Studios, responsible for shaping the franchise’s future. As he prepares to guide one of the most recognizable superheroes back to the forefront of cinema, this dual role presents a fascinating dynamic. “When you create a movie, especially a big spectacle film, you’re creating a giant machine that’s supposed to have an effect,” he notes, underscoring the importance of engineering a cinematic experience that satisfies both artistic vision and audience expectations.
